Tampa Bay Buccaneers 2012 Head Coach Search: Joe Philbin to be interviewed

The Tampa Bay Buccaneers received permission on Monday to interview Green Bay Packers offensive coordinator Joe Philbin. Philbin is coming off a tough two weeks, losing his son in a tragic drowning accident and losing against the New York Giants on Sunday. Since he has taken over as offensive coordinator for the Packers in 2007, his teams have been in the top ten in total points and yards every season. With Josh Freeman and the stable of wide receivers in Tampa, Philbin has all the tools needed to be successful and then some. Though his teams have never been better than 14th in total rushing yards, he has never had a dependable work horse back like Legarrette Blount.

The Miami Dolphins have already interviewed Joe Philbin and he is said to be the only true other candidate for their head coach job. The other one is Mike Zimmer, whom the Buccaneers interviewed today. Like the Dolphins, Philbin is only the second real candidate the Buccaneers should look at pursuing. The Bucs need to interview Philbin ASAP and make a solid offer to either coach before one or both of these guys are signed. The Oakland Raiders have expressed interest in Philbin as well and both he and Zimmer are likely to be off the market within a week or so given they are two hot commodities. Joe Philbin fits better than Zimmer into the Buccaneers personnel make up and probably jumps to the top of the list.
